Well, bird #2 of the season got on the ground 15 minutes into my first hunt in SE Alabama this past Saturday... After getting rained out all day long Friday, my brother & I were itching to get out & hunt together - and apparently the birds were ready to get their groove on, as well; lots of gobbling, even though it was very windy, spitting rain, cloudy, etc. - not your blue bird sky turkey morning at all... After we heard our first gobbler, we setup on him & called & within less than 5 minutes, we had a jake & a hen come running into our setup (we were inside the huge limbs of a downed oak tree in our pasture; made for an awesome blind)... We decided to let him go, in favor of pulling in big boy... After another 10 minutes or so, 5 gobblers stepped into the lower corner of the pasture, and we got very excited - until we realized, all of 'em were jakes! :( Well, since we obviously have an abundance of jakes, I decided to go ahead & blast the biggest one once they got into gun range...
Glad I took him, as the following day, we were met with *NO* gobbling at all, but stumbled onto a pile of turkeys, with a huge strutter on my PawPaw's land; my brother made the crawl on him & got to within 50 or so steps - fired off a shot - and missed!! :( He was pretty sick about that all day, and half of the next day... :) We only heard sparse gobbling Monday thru today, when I had to return home...
My brother's step-son's cat got into my fan and tore it a new one; not sure if it's salvagable or not, but... Oh well, it was just a jake - although it had some really nice, pretty red hues to the feathers, which I don't see around my neck of the woods... All in all, we had a blast - got on birds the entire time, but only got 'em into gun range twice... We're super excited about the coming years of turkey hunting; a lot of promising signs of birds on our land & surrounding properties, it appears...
